Nora Fatehi has become a household name after gaining recognition for her booming career in the acting industry. The professional dancer garnered a massive fan-following for her social media presence. In 2018, she appeared in hit music videos Dilbar, which crossed one billion views on Youtube, and opened up newer opportunities for her to present her talent. Over the years, Nora has starred in numerous Bollywood films including Bharat, Stree, Batla House, Roar, and Satyameva Jayate.

Mumbai: Bollywood actors, musicians and filmmakers took to social media on Thursday night to express shock and mourn the demise of music composer Shravan Rathod of the popular Nadeem-Shravan duo.
Shravan breathed his last in Mumbai around 9.30 pm on Thursday. The renowned composer succumbed to Covid-19.
Confirming the news, trade analyst Komal Nahta tweeted: Terrible news. Music director Shravan breathes his last, loses battle with COVID-19. Very sad day for music industry.
